Covenant girls lacrosse rolls to quarterfinal win

It didn’t take long for No. 2-seeded Covenant to take control.

The Eagles’ girls lacrosse squad made short work of Middleburg Academy Thursday afternoon in the VISAA Division 2 quarterfinals, rolling 16-8 to advance to the state tournament’s semifinal round at Old Dominion University in Norfolk.

Rachel Rapp led the way early with a four-goal first half, attacking seemingly at will from the top of the offensive formation. Taylor Brown also notched four goals for the game while also dishing out a pair of assists for Covenant.

The Eagles also got two-goal efforts from Sadie Bryant, Charlotte Delaney and Virginia Dittmar. Delaney also had two assists. Jenna Clark’s one-goal, one-assist outing and Alicia Fox’s goal rounded out the scoring for the Eagles.

Covenant will face Highland in the state semifinals after Highland knocked off Norfolk Collegiate 20-8 Tuesday. Foxcroft and Cape Henry will face off in the other semifinal.
